Can public spaces in Mallorca be planted with trees or palms without permission?

Not usually. In Mallorca, planting in public space can raise legal questions if the land is not clearly assigned or if the planting changes how the area is used. A simple planting action can become sensitive when ownership, maintenance and responsibility are unclear.
